在MySQL或MariaDB中,任意时间对数据库所做的修改,都会被记录到日志文件中。例如,当你添加了一个新的表,或者更新了一条数据,这些事件都会被存储到二进制日志文件中。二进制日志文件在MySQL主从复合中是非常有用的,主服务器会发送其数据到远程服务器中。 当你需要恢复MySQL时,也会需要使用到二进制日志文件。mysqlbinlog 命令,以用户可视的方式展示出二进制日志中的内容。同时
# MySQL binlog 过滤完整SQL ## 简介 MySQL binlog 是 MySQL 数据库的二进制日志文件,记录了数据库的所有变更操作。通过解析 binlog 可以实时监控和还原数据库操作。在实际应用中,我们可能需要过滤出特定的 SQL 语句进行分析或者恢复数据。 本文将介绍如何使用 MySQL binlog 过滤出完整SQL 语句,并给出代码示例帮助读者快速上手。 #
原创 2024-06-08 03:43:12
265阅读
# 如何实现“mysqlbinlog sql” 作为一名经验丰富的开发者,我将会教你如何实现“mysqlbinlog sql”。 ## 流程图 ```mermaid flowchart TD A[连接到MySQL数据库] --> B[导出binlog文件] B --> C[解析binlog文件] C --> D[获取sql语句] ``` ## 步骤表格 | 步骤
原创 2024-04-10 06:04:35
15阅读
#通过mysqlbinlog查看binglog日志,结果生产到1.sql文件 #base64-output,可以控制输出语句输出base64编码的BINLOG语句;decode-rows:配合--verbose选项一起使用解码行事件到带注释的伪SQL语句 #-v, --verbose 重新构建伪SQL语句的行信息输出,-v -v会增加列类型的注释信息。 mysqlbinlog --no-defau
转载 2023-09-01 08:08:42
232阅读
# 使用mysqlbinlog查看SQL ## 介绍 mysqlbinlog是MySQL自带的一个命令行工具,用于查看二进制日志文件(binlog)中的SQL语句。binlog是MySQL服务器记录的所有数据更改操作(如插入、更新、删除)的二进制日志文件,它可以用于数据恢复、数据同步等操作。 mysqlbinlog可以将二进制日志文件以文本形式输出,方便我们查看和分析其中的SQL语句。本文将
原创 2024-01-08 04:09:25
122阅读
# 了解MySQL二进制日志(mysqlbinlog)及其使用 MySQL是一个广泛使用的关系型数据库管理系统,而MySQL二进制日志(mysqlbinlog)则是MySQL数据库中用于记录二进制日志的工具。二进制日志是MySQL中非常重要的一部分,它记录了数据库中所有的更改操作,包括增加、删除、修改数据等。 ## 什么是MySQL二进制日志(mysqlbinlog) MySQL二进制日志(
原创 2024-04-20 05:28:25
23阅读
# 使用mysqlbinlog导出SQL文件 ## 简介 `mysqlbinlog` 是 MySQL 中的一个命令行工具,用于解析和打印二进制日志文件(binlog)。通过解析 binlog 文件,我们可以获取数据库的历史操作记录,包括增删改查语句,以及对表结构的修改。 本文将介绍如何使用 `mysqlbinlog` 工具导出 SQL 文件,并通过一些实际例子来说明它的用法和注意事项。 #
原创 2023-09-13 07:28:21
747阅读
# 通过mysqlbinlog查找SQL语句简介 在MySQL数据库中,mysqlbinlog是一个用于查看和分析二进制日志文件的工具。通过mysqlbinlog工具,我们可以查看数据库的变更日志,分析数据库操作的历史记录,以便进行数据恢复、数据库性能优化等操作。本文将介绍如何使用mysqlbinlog工具来查找SQL语句,并给出代码示例。 ## mysqlbinlog工具简介 mysqlb
原创 2024-05-12 04:05:29
99阅读
## mysqlbinlogSQL 的流程 首先,让我们来了解一下 mysqlbinlogSQL 的整个流程。下面的表格展示了每个步骤以及需要做的事情: | 步骤 | 描述 | | --- | --- | | 1 | 安装 mysqlbinlog 工具 | | 2 | 导出 binlog 文件 | | 3 | 解析 binlog 文件 | | 4 | 转换为 SQL 语句 | 下
原创 2023-11-18 03:22:34
124阅读
## mysqlbinlog 查看sql ### 1. 简介 在MySQL数据库中,`mysqlbinlog`是一个用于查看二进制日志文件内容的工具。二进制日志文件记录了MySQL数据库中的所有修改操作,包括插入、更新、删除等操作。通过使用`mysqlbinlog`,我们可以将二进制日志文件还原成原始的SQL语句,从而进行SQL的分析和调试。 ### 2. 使用流程 下面是使用`mysql
原创 2023-07-22 20:15:39
443阅读
# MySQLbinlog反向SQL实现指南 ## 1. 简介 MySQLbinlog是MySQL数据库的二进制日志文件,记录了数据库的所有变更操作,包括插入、更新和删除等操作。通过解析binlog文件,我们可以还原数据库的历史操作,并生成相应的SQL语句。本文将教会你如何使用MySQLbinlog来进行反向SQL操作。 ## 2. 流程概述 下面是使用MySQLbinlog反向SQL的整个流
原创 2024-01-21 09:29:58
343阅读
如何使用mysqlbinlog实现特定sql ## 一、整体流程 下面是使用mysqlbinlog实现特定sql的整体流程: | 步骤 | 描述 | | ---- | ---- | | 1 | 下载并安装mysqlbinlog工具 | | 2 | 导出binlog文件 | | 3 | 解析binlog文件 | | 4 | 过滤出特定sql | | 5 | 分析特定sql | 接下来,我将具
原创 2023-12-16 03:46:31
32阅读
1.binlog日志基本知识MySQL的二进制日志binlog可以说是MySQL最重要的日志,它记录了所有的DDL和DML语句(除了数据查询语句select),以事件形式记录,还包含语句所执行的消耗的时间。binlog有三种格式:Statement、Row以及Mixed。分别是:基于SQL语句的复制(statement-based replication,SBR)、 基于行的复制(row
转载 10月前
107阅读
# mysqlbinlog 看明文SQL的实现流程 ## 1. 简介 在MySQL数据库中,二进制日志(binary log)是记录了数据库的所有更改操作的日志文件。mysqlbinlog 是 MySQL 提供的一个命令行工具,可以用来解析二进制日志,查看其中记录的 SQL 语句。本文将介绍如何使用 mysqlbinlog 来查看明文 SQL。 ## 2. 实现步骤 下表展示了实现 "mys
原创 2023-10-26 03:33:00
189阅读
# MySQL Binlog查询执行SQL 在MySQL数据库中,Binlog是一种二进制日志文件,用于记录数据库的所有更改操作,包括插入、更新和删除等操作。使用mysqlbinlog命令可以解析和查询Binlog文件,以便了解和还原数据库的历史操作。 ## 什么是Binlog? Binlog(Binary Log)是MySQL数据库中的一种日志文件,用于记录数据库中的所有更改操作。它以二进
原创 2023-08-01 06:14:30
220阅读
## MySQL Binlog 解析找 SQL MySQL binlog(二进制日志)是 MySQL 数据库中非常重要的一个组成部分,它记录了所有对数据库进行更改的操作(如 INSERT、UPDATE、DELETE 等),这些操作是按照执行顺序记录的。通过分析 binlog,我们可以了解到数据库在某个时间点上发生了什么变化,这对于数据库的维护和故障排查非常重要。 在某些情况下,我们可能需要从
原创 2024-07-20 03:55:36
49阅读
# 使用mysqlbinlog解析出SQL语句 在MySQL数据库中,有时候我们需要查看数据库中的操作记录,比如查询某个表的更新、插入、删除操作,或者查看某个特定时间段内的操作记录。而这些信息可以通过MySQL的二进制日志(binlog)来获取。mysqlbinlog是MySQL提供的一个用来解析二进制日志的工具,通过它我们可以将二进制日志文件中的操作记录解析成SQL语句进行查看。 ## 什么
原创 2024-04-08 04:59:06
233阅读
    同大多数关系型数据库一样,日志文件是MySQL数据库的重要组成部分。MySQL有几种不同的日志文件,通常包括错误日志文件,二进制日志,通用日志,慢查询日志,等等。这些日志可以帮助我们定位mysqld内部发生的事件,数据库性能故障,记录数据的变更历史,用户恢复数据库等等。本文主要描述通用查询日志。1、MySQL日志文件系统的组成  &nbsp
tableEnv.executeSql("create table mysql_binlog(\n "+ "id STRING not null,\n"+ "region_name STRING ,\n"+ "primary key(id) NOT ENFORCED \n"+ //两个条件缺一不可
原创 2023-04-19 18:02:29
734阅读
1点赞
2评论
# mysqlbinlog 查看sql语句实现方法 ## 概述 在MySQL数据库中,mysqlbinlog命令可用于查看二进制日志文件中的SQL语句。通过使用该命令,我们可以了解数据库的变更历史,以及执行的SQL操作。本文将引导一名刚入行的开发者学习如何使用mysqlbinlog来查看SQL语句。 ## 流程 下面是使用mysqlbinlog查看SQL语句的步骤: ```mermaid
原创 2023-11-01 12:39:54
103阅读
  • 1
  • 2
  • 3
  • 4
  • 5